Exam pattern
Candidates who will appear for KCET 2018 will have to go through the exam pattern including all the relevant details about the examination syllabus, question paper and OMR sheets. The exam pattern will be as follows:

Duration and subjects of examination The KCET 2018 will be held on two days in four different sessions for four subjects.

The Examination for Biology and Mathematics will be conducted on the first day in two sessions and Physics and Chemistry examination will be on the second day in next two sessions.

Each exam/subject will be of 80 minutes and carry 60 marks.

Type of Questions Each paper will consist of Multiple-Choice Questions. Each question paper will be in 16 versions and each question will have four answer options.

Marking Scheme Each question will carry one mark and there will be no negative marking for wrong answers.

OMR Sheet A model of Optical Mark Reader (OMR) sheets will be given to the candidates for marking answers. A specimen of OMR sheet will be hosted by the KEA

Examination Syllabus The Syllabus for the examination will be based on the First and Second PUC syllabi prescribed by the Pre-University Education of Karnataka State.
